Transaction d693ec2ea31cb4f2f005ecd486c71d48de32fc708ca16334adc28e566293a8bc

1 Input
2 Outputs
  • d693ec2ea31cb4f2f005ecd486c71d48de32fc708ca16334adc28e566293a8bc:0
  • value  109982062
    address  132WRrFKYoSHC5VKzRh7sUaBTUA6n1qc1N
  • d693ec2ea31cb4f2f005ecd486c71d48de32fc708ca16334adc28e566293a8bc:1
  • value  103058311
    address  1DZFTuADe1Qmg58U2umBEWbgJWpBDFU7pZ